China's Wealth Breeds Obesity, Sparking Boom in Stomach Surgery
By John Liu

Jan. 10 (Bloomberg) -- Zheng Chengzhu started researching surgeries to treat weight-related illnesses in China 12 years ago, when he saw his countrymen getting richer -- and fatter.

Now Zheng, 47, chief of surgery at Shanghai's Changhai Hospital, is a profiting from a fast-growing market. ``When Chinese people get money, the first thing they do is invite all their friends out to dinner,'' he said.

The girth of China's affluent classes is expanding as fast- food chains such as Kentucky Fried Chicken win converts. The number of obese people tripled to 90 million as the economy grew sevenfold from 1992 to 2006, the World Health Organization says.

Chinese aged from 35 to 64 are twice as likely as Americans to die of heart disease, according to the WHO. The number of diabetes sufferers may double to 42 million by 2030.

``The economy has grown so fast and the country has changed so much that people haven't been able to adapt,'' said Henk Bekedam, 48, the WHO's chief China representative in Beijing. ``Obesity is more of a threat than avian flu and much more difficult to treat.''

They seasonally adjust this crap. The two weeks at the end of the year are probably the slowest of all, and therefore subject to the largest adjustment. They're also adjusted for being 4 day weeks. I do not trust these numbers.

For what it's worth, they are virtually unchanged from the year ago numbers. Does that seem right based on the anecdotal evidence?

REgarding the mortgage aps. Just looking at the Realtors contract data for December 2005, unadjusted. It was the lowest level of the year, rock bottom. If the mortgage aps data is correct in that this year is about the same as last year, then they are the same as last year's lousy level, which is not what I would call a recovery. It's just a pause before the next leg down.
